The Rent Relief Program, launched in mid-December, offers grants of up to $30,000 per unit to eligible landlords for expenses incurred since April 1, 2022. The primary focus of this initiative is to provide support to small landlords who own up to four rental units. The overarching goal is to minimize tenant evictions, maintain ..read more

The ULA ERAP is aimed at assisting low-income residential renters in Los Angeles who are at risk of homelessness due to unpaid rent resulting from COVID-19 or other financial hardships. The program provides up to six months of rental arrears to eligible tenants. Landlords who own 12 or fewer units and have rental properties within the city are ..read more

On Monday, October 16th, the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) and the Federal Housing Administration (FHA) announced a new policy allowing lenders to consider income from Accessory Dwelling Units (ADUs) when underwriting a mortgage.
